## What is Wikipanion Plus for iPad?

Wikipanion Plus for iPad is a reference tool designed to enhance the Wikipedia browsing experience. It introduces advanced reading management features, including background downloading and offline access, to improve content consumption efficiency.

<!-- SECTION: Key Features -->
## Key Features

- **Queue Mode**: Allows users to curate a list of Wikipedia entries to read at a later time.
- **Offline Browsing**: Enables users to save Wikipedia entries for access without an active internet connection.
- **Background Downloading**: Downloads saved entries in the background, allowing users to continue browsing without interruption.
